Creeaza.com - informatii profesionale despre


Cunostinta va deschide lumea intelepciunii - Referate profesionale unice
Acasa » scoala » informatica » catia
Filetarea propriu-zisa se executa in frazele N11, N15

Filetarea propriu-zisa se executa in frazele N11, N15


Filetarea propriu-zisa se executa in frazele N11, N15
Exemplul 3: fig 1.4.

 




Figura 1.4 Filetarea frontala

- filetare frontala (o spirala arhimedica) cu adancimea de 2 mm si pasul de 4 mm.

N10 G27 60 G90 X36 G 90 Z74

N11 G33 X104 I4

N12 G0 Z76

N13 X36

N14 Z76

N15 G33 X104 I4

N16 G0 Z76

Functia G4 defineste o temporizare, de valoare cuprinsa sub adresa I, in domeniul [0,25500] ms.

Exemplu: N10 G1 X Z0 G4 I10

Utilitatea existentei unei temporizari este impusa de necesitatea schimbarii sculelor, a evacuarii spanului, verificarilor dimensionale interfazice..

b. G28, G29, G39 - sunt valide numai in cazul strungurilor, generand o autoprogramare pentru strunjire frontala si respectiv longitudinala.

Aceste functii sunt dintre cele mai puternice realizari "soft" ale echipamentelor de tip CNC 600.

In fig.5.5. se prezinta cazul autoprogramarii pentru strunjire longitudinala.

 


Figura 1.5 Autoprogramarea pentru strunjire longizudinala

Programul corespunzator este prezentat in continuare:

%1

: 1 G36 X Z5800 T0 101 M3 M23

N2 G92 X Z 1

: 3 G0 G38 G60 X87 Z 219 F 0.5 5200 R20 M41 L1

N4 G36 X Z 5800

N5 G92 X Z

: 6 G96 X27 Z219 T0 202 5200 F0.1 M23 M4 L1

N7 G36 X27 Z215

L1

N100 G1 X27 Z215

N101 Z185

N102 X42

N103 G3 X55 Z172 J55 K185

N104 G1 Z120

N105 X60

N106 X73 Z120

N107 X80

N108 Z100

N109 G39 X87 M22 S 1600

T01/60/30//

T02/60/30//

In concluzie G28 valideaza autoprogramarea trebuind sa fie neaparat urmata de G38 in cazul strunjirii frontale, dar nefiind necesar sa fie urmata de G39 in cazul strunjirii longitudinale; G39 - invalideaza (specifica terminarea autoprogramarii).

c. G26 - specifica programarea pe raza in cazul strunjirii; ea este implicata (in cazul lipsei lui G26 sau G27 se considera automat programarea pe raza);

G27 - programarea pe diametru.

d. Functiile definind prelucrarea dupa echidistanta

Se introduce notiunea de echidistanta in modul urmator: avand data o curba plana (uzual profilul nominal al piesei), construind in fiecare punct normala la curba si luand pe fiecare normala un segment de valoare constanta la cea initiala.

In procesul prelucrarii, centrul sculei se deplaseaza dupa o directie echidistanta astfel incat infasuratoarea pozitiilor succesive ale acesteia sa genereze tocmai profilul nominal. Valoarea echidistantei este suma razei sculei, a adaosului de prelucrare si eventual a interstitiului tehnologic (la prelucrarile prin eroziune de exemplu).

 


Figura 1.6 Explicativa pentru notiunea de echidistanta

Se utilizeaza doua functii specifice pentru precizarea pozitiei centrului sculei fata de conturul nominal de prelucrat;

G41 - centrul sculei se va plasa la stanga conturului nominal in sensul de prelucrare;

G42 - identic, dar plasare la dreapta;

G40 - sfarsitul prelucrarii dupa echidistanta;

Fraza in care este prezenta functia GG41 sau G42 defineste dreapta de intrare si ea trebuie sa fie in afara profilului piesei.

Problemele de generare a echidistantei sunt foarte delicate, in anumite situatii existand nedeterminari ; in aceste situatii se folosesc functii suplimentare pentru definirea solutiei;

G44 - comanda realizarea unei echidistante cu colt, obtinuta strict prin intersectarea celor doua drepte echidistante: fig 1.7 a) pentru exterior si fig.5.7 b) pentru interior.

Figura 1.7 Realizarea unei echidistante cu colt

G45 - comanda realizarea unei echidistante cu arc de cerc la racordarea celor doua drepte echidistante partiale: fig. 1.8. (este considerata implicit in lipsa oricarei specificatii racordarea se va face cu ajutorul unui arc de cerc).

 


Figura 1.7 Realizarea unei echidistante cu racordare

Observatie: In cazul echipamentelor pentru frezare functiile G28, G29, G31, G30 , au o cu totul alta semnificatie decat in cazul strunjirii, si anume aceea de a prelucra in oglinda, dupa cum urmeaza:

G28 - fara oglindire, este considerata implicit;

G29 - oglindire numai dupa axa 2;

G30 - oglindire numai dupa axa 1;

G31 - oglindire dupa ambele axe.

e. Deplasari rapide in puncte fixe

G32 - capul de lucru se va deplasa in punctul de schimbare a sculelor;

G36 - deplasarea rapida in punctul de inceput al programului;

G37 - deplasare in punctul de referinta; acesta este caracteristic masinii respective si atingerea sa este mai intotdeauna obligatorie la reluarea prelucrarii dupa oprirea masinii.

f. Deplasarea punctului de zero

Prin punct de zero se intelege originea sistemului de coordonate atasat piesei (nul punct sau punct fix). Localizarea acestuia de catre echipamentul CNC se face prin operatia de centrare (pozitionare) initiala a sculei fata de semifabricat, si in general este dependenta de maiestria operatorului, in multe cazuri contribuind decisiv la obtinerea preciziei de prelucrare. In anumite situatii este totusi necesara o deplasare existand posibilitatea utilizarii unor functii astfel:

G53 - nu permite deplasarea punctului de zero;

G54, G55 - permite cate o deplasare a punctului de zero.

g. G63 - filetare cu tarodul sau filiera existenta numai pe echipamente de tip CNC 600-1 pentru strunguri.

h. Tipuri de interpretare a coordonatelor

G90 - este considerata implicit si genereaza o programare in coordonate (orice coordonata reprezinta o valoare absoluta in sistemul de coordonate precizat).

G91 - coordonate relative (orice coordonata pe axa respectiva este interpretata ca diferenta algebrica intre pozitia viitoare si cea actuala a elementului la care se refera).

Observatie: In cadrul aceleasi fraze pot coexista axe programate absolut si axe programate relativ.

Exemplu: N4 G91 X690 I25 G91 Y 310.690 J0.

Astfel coordonatele centrului cercului au fost precizate absolut, iar coordonatele punctului de sfarsit al arcului de cerc relativ.

i. Moduri de selectare a unitatii de masura pentru avansuri.

G94 - implicit, avansul se va interpreta in mm/min.

G95 - interpretare in mm/rot.





Politica de confidentialitate


creeaza logo.com Copyright © 2024 - Toate drepturile rezervate.
Toate documentele au caracter informativ cu scop educational.